The point of his "death" and immediate return was to desensitize the player to realistic death and prevent them from expecting anything to actually happen to [spoiler]Aerith later. This was further capitalized upon by making it appear that
(SPOILER)Aerith would be alright when the other party members stopped Cloud from crushing her beneath the Buster Sword. Thus, it was totally unexpected and truly brought home how unexpected and undramatic a thing death is. The dramatic build up had already come and gone when the form of Sephiroth dropped in and slid a long cold blade through Aerith's spine.
